West Brom are back on top of the Sky Bet Championship after beating Stoke City 2-0 on Monday night and it is clear that the Baggies are going to take some stopping this season.

From the back of the pitch to the sharp end, they are looking very strong at the moment and it is evident that the men from the Hawthorns are one of the favourites for promotion at this stage of the campaign.

The Baggies are flying along, then, and under manager Slaven Bilic there is a really nice balance to this team, with them controlling the match v the Potters yesterday evening.

The former West Ham and Croatia manager has got plenty of fans amongst the Baggies’ faithful at the moment, too, with him sending a message to those that travel away with the club on Twitter last night.
